Decentralized VPNs: The Future of Privacy Online
The internet landscape is rapidly shifting, and with it, the need for robust security measures. Enter decentralized VPNs, a groundbreaking innovation that promises to transform the way we browse online. Unlike traditional centralized VPNs, which rely on a single server controlled by a provider, decentralized VPNs leverage a network of users to encrypt and route your internet traffic. This structure offers several benefits. First and foremost, it enhances security by eliminating the single point of failure that centralized VPNs present. By distributing your data across multiple nodes, decentralized VPNs make it significantly harder for hackers to intercept or compromise your information.
Additionally, decentralized VPNs often boast greater transparency. Because the network is open-source, users can examine the code and verify its functionality. This level of visibility fosters trust and confidence in the system.
While decentralized VPNs are still a relatively emerging technology, they have the potential to become the future for secure browsing. As more users adopt this innovative approach to privacy and security, we can expect to see widespread adoption and further development in the field.
Turn Off Your iPhone's VPN Connection
Want to halt your iPhone's VPN connection? It's easy peasy. First, open the App Settings on your device. Then, scroll down and tap the "VPN" choice. Tap on that to view the VPN connections list. Next, select the VPN connection you want to turn off. Finally, tap the button next to the connection name . This will disable your VPN connection. Your iPhone will now use its default network settings.
